Output 3dbd16791d6751bfbc5e0a8d9aeceb095ae9fdd2ef0a57cdf5c8d5d98f89aff7:1

value
1347994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f063f2afa39cc1605237fe8ba8dc51dc4b510c9 OP_EQUAL
address
3EjG31NiDoQebkg37JmHrtdD8RtWaWJgtN
transaction
3dbd16791d6751bfbc5e0a8d9aeceb095ae9fdd2ef0a57cdf5c8d5d98f89aff7
confirmations
154258
spent
true